BOARD OF DIRECTORS
 
President of Institute of the Southwest and Rescue Director

Janet Meyer, Ph.D., EBW is the founder and president of Institute of the Southwest and the director of Spirit of Equus Rescue. Dr. Meyer has been a professional educator for 25 years serving as an administrator and professor at the college level. She has a B.S. in biology, a medical background and retains certifications in stress management, Reiki & equine bodywork. In 2001 she became a horse owner and it changed her life!

Vice-President Nora Buck
 
Nora began her term as Vice President on Monday, April 5, 2010, replacing Jaya Daniel.  We thank Jaya for her year of service to our Rescue and wish her well!
 
Nora has a beautiful 5 acre farm in Nipomo and owns 2 horses. Nick is a spotted saddle horse, and Quentin is her newly acquired Freisian gelding.
Raised on a farm in Michigan, Nora houses pigmy goats, a llama, rescued dogs and cats, and a variety of farm animals.
 
Nora met the Rescue director in 2001 when they were boarding their horses at the same stable in Somis. Nora attends natural horsemanship events and is living out her dream to have her horses on her own property.
 
She is an avid trail rider, loves to ride on the beach, and is very supportive of all forms of Rescue.
